[eside-ghost] Ordenador distribuido
Jon Ander Ortiz
jonbaine en gmail.com
Mie Mayo 9 14:27:31 CEST 2007
Iepa!!!
>
> Vaya, openmosix+dfsa parece ser exactamente en lo que estaba
> pensando... No sabia que la migracion de procesos fuera tan "facil",
> de hecho pensaba q seria imposible en cuanto varían las cpus. Por
> ejemplo... nose, si un proceso usa un registro presente en las cpus
> con SSE2, y se intenta pasar a un 486, no petaría eso por todos laos?
En OpenMosix se utiliza un emulador de VM86, para distribuir los procesos,
es decir, que de esta manera se realiza los clusters "heterogeneos". Claro,
que si un proceso daría problemas si hace uso de:
* Operaciones propias de una arquitectura. concreta.
* Utiliza memoria compartida.
* Accede a registros de dispositivos dispositivos o a memoria DMA de la RAM
(Direct memory access).
* No se puede ejecutar en modo VM86
En principio openMosix no sabe si un proceso va a hacer algo de lo que hemos
comentado por lo que por defecto, si nadie le dice nada migra el proceso,
pero si ejecutando pasa lo siguiente:
A ) Si hace referencia a algo concreto de la máquina en la que se ha
arrancado (mem. compartida, acceso a registros de dispositivos... ) migra el
proceso a la máquina que ha iniciado el proceso.
B ) Si utiliza alguna instrucción de alguna arch. concreta, migra el proceso
a alguna máquina de el cluster con esa arquitectura.
Mola ehhh??
La verdad es que esta muy currado y es SW libre ^^
No he leido mucho sobre el tema de DFSA... no me queda claro si se usa
> exclusivamente para poder migrar procesos, o puede ser usado tb por el
> usuario final (aka procesos que no necesitan migrar ni han sido
> migrados), como si fuera un especie de SAMBA masivo. Alguien sabe como
> va?
> --
De esto no se ni que es :S
Un saludete:
jonan
Saludos,
> STenyaK
>
> _______________________________________________
> Site: http://1ksurvivor.homeip.net <1kSurvivor>
> http://motorsport-sim.org <Motorsport>
> http://kwh.iespana.es <KuantikalWareHouse>
> http://emuletutorial.info <EmuleTutorial>
> ICQ: 153709484
> Mail: stenyak AT gmail DOT com
> _______________________________________________
> eside-ghost mailing list
> eside-ghost en deusto.es
> https://listas.deusto.es/mailman/listinfo/eside-ghost
>
------------ próxima parte ------------
Se ha borrado un adjunto en formato HTML...
URL: https://listas.deusto.es/mailman/private/eside-ghost/attachments/20070509/b1ffb002/attachment.htm
Más información sobre la lista de distribución eside-ghost